Hole in the wall fire surround

Ethanol wall mounted fireplaces are a great alternative to gas fires They are simple to use and offer the atmosphere of a conventional fireplace without the setup and maintenance of a chimney. They are likewise really affordable due to the fact that you can buy your fuel straight from the maker. It is delivered to your door in quart-sized bottles that are easy to shop and manage. The bio ethanol used in this type of fireplace is non-toxic and produces no fumes or smoke. They can be easily installed by a professional or DIY homeowner.

A hole-in-the-wall fireplace can be built into a new or existing bookcase or media wall It is very important to select materials with high insulating residential or commercial properties to minimise the transfer of heat from the fireplace to the TV. This is particularly essential in homes with children. To secure your children, make sure that the ethanol burner is not within 40 inches of any drapes or drapes. In addition, the top of the fireplace ought to be at least 36 inches from the ceiling.

The initial step in installing a hole-in-the-wall fire surround is to cut a hole in the wall. Follow the manufacturers directions to make sure that you make a hole that is the ideal size. The next step is to build a frame around the opening. This can be made from wood or a non-combustible product such as oxygenated concrete. You should likewise install a metal backer board to avoid the walls from splitting or deforming due to the heat from the fireplace.

After you have actually completed the construction, you can install the fireplace unit. You can pick from a variety of styles, consisting of the popular frameless design. These designs look stunning in modern spaces and are readily available in a vast array of surfaces, such as black or white. They are also ideal for spaces with limited wall area.

A hole-in-the-wall fire surround can be paired with a range of fuel beds, such as the Crystal Fires Royale 4 Sided Hole in the Wall with Gem Gas Fire or the Verine Celena HE High Efficiency Hole in the Wall Gas Fire. If you prefer a conventional design, there are likewise log-effect and coal-effect fuel beds offered for this kind of fire.
Built-in fires.

The media wall is a popular function in modern homes and can serve a variety of purposes. For example, it can be utilized to house a bioethanol fireplace, which is an excellent method to create a warm and welcoming environment in your house. These units are also ideal for people who do not have a chimney breast. They can be built into an existing wall or added to a new bookcase or wall-mounted system.

A bioethanol fire is a great alternative for a media wall since it provides real flames and heat without the need for flue or gas. It's likewise simple to utilize-- just put the fuel in the burner box and light it. There's no unpleasant cleanup or upkeep required, and it can be rearranged in the space as required.

While a bioethanol fire doesn't produce as much heat as a log-burning fireplace, it can still offer a nice cosy atmosphere and include heat to a room. It can even be utilized as a centerpiece for a room, including character and making it feel more inviting.
